What is an On-Grid Battery Storage System?
On-grid battery storage systems are connected to the public electricity grid and work in tandem with solar panels. These systems allow homeowners to use solar energy during the day and store excess power for later use or export to the grid β reducing dependency on expensive electricity.

What is an Off-Grid System?
Off-grid battery systems are entirely independent from the utility grid. Powered by solar panels and optionally a generator, they supply energy to remote homes, mobile setups, or locations without infrastructure.
π Common Use Cases
- Remote cottages and holiday homes
- Off-grid lodges, cabins, or camps
- Mobile medical or telecom stations

What is a Hybrid System?
Hybrid battery systems combine grid connection and off-grid capability. They provide backup during blackouts while optimising energy between solar, grid, and battery for maximum efficiency.
